St Paul hosted the Bass Lake Ministry at the Melody Drive-In at Bass Lake on June 22nd, July 20th and Aug 17th this summer.
A children's chat was added this summer to reach out to younger attendees. The June 22nd chat was titled "Putting on the Armor of God" taken from Ephesians 6:10-18. The July 20 chat was postponed due to a rain storm that brought much needed rain to the region. The Aug 17th chat was titled "Fishers of Men" taken from Matthew 4:19.
Julie Hanus explained the meanings of the verses using everyday objects, toys and games the children could see and touch. Lauren Redlin would demonstrate these objects, toys and games to help explain these meanings to the youngsters. A craft with the same message was given to the children to take home and assemble to reinforce the theme of the day. Pastor Fakih supported Julie and Lauren with loving guidance and suggestions.

St Paul celebrated Mission Sunday on March 30, 2025 with special guest speaker the Rev. Dr. Geoffrey L. Robinson. Pastor Robinson is the Executive for Outreach and Human Care with the Indiana District Lutheran Church-Missouri Synod and gave a sermonette and PowerPoint presentation on current mission projects within the state of Indiana.
